Amy Schumer on Moving Encounter with Holocaust Survivor: 'Honor of a Lifetime'

Summary by סרוגים
Amy Schumer, the American and Jewish star, publishes a special post in honor of Holocaust Remembrance Day. In both a post and a story she uploaded to her Instagram account, she wrote how excited she was to meet Holocaust survivor Elizabeth Black: “It was amazing to meet her.
